هل يجب علي تعطيل ملف الصفحات إذا كان جهاز الكمبيوتر يحتوي على الكثير من ذاكرة الوصول العشوائي؟
إذا كان لديك جهاز كمبيوتر يحتوي على كمية كبيرة من ذاكرة الوصول العشوائي ، فهل ستحصل على أي فوائد من تعطيل ملف الصفحة أم يجب عليك أن تترك بشكل جيد بما فيه الكفاية؟ يناقش SuperUser Q & A اليوم الموضوع للمساعدة في إرضاء فضول القارئ.
تأتي جلسة الأسئلة والأجوبة اليوم مقدمة من SuperUser-a subdivision of Stack Exchange ، وهي مجموعة مجتمعية مدفوعة من مواقع Q & A.
الصورة مجاملة من كولين أندرسون (فليكر).
السؤال
يريد مستخدم SuperUser reader user1306322 معرفة ما إذا كان هناك أي فوائد لتعطيل ملف الصفحة إذا كان جهاز كمبيوتر الشخص لديه ذاكرة وصول عشوائي كبيرة:
تخيل أن لدي الكثير من ذاكرة الوصول العشوائي ، على سبيل المثال 64 غيغابايت ، على سبيل المثال. هذا كثير ، حتى بالنسبة لأجهزة الكمبيوتر الألعاب. الآن الموقع الافتراضي لملف صفحة في Windows موجود على محرك نظام التشغيل الرئيسي (سواء كان HDD أو SSD) ، وهو أسرع بشكل عام ولكنه لا يزال بالسرعة القصوى لذاكرة الوصول العشوائي (RAM).
يخبرني شيء ما أن تعطيل ملف الصفحة على القرص الصلب أو إنشاء محرك أقراص RAM ظاهري وترك ملف الصفحة يمكن أن يجعل Windows ينقل كل الذاكرة الظاهرية إلى ذاكرة الوصول العشوائي (RAM) ويزيد من أداء النظام. لكنني لست على دراية كبيرة في هذا المجال ، لذلك قد لا يكون ذلك صحيحًا على الإطلاق.
حاولت كليهما ، لكني لم أتمكن من تحليل النتائج للوصول إلى نتيجة محددة مع مستوى علمي في المسائل المتعلقة بالذاكرة. هل هذا العمل؟ إذا لم يكن كذلك ، فلماذا?
هل سيحقق user1306322 أي فوائد من تعطيل ملف الصفحة?
الاجابة
مساهم SuperUser ديفيد شوارتز لديه الجواب بالنسبة لنا:
بغض النظر عن مقدار ذاكرة الوصول العشوائي لديك ، فأنت تريد أن يتمكن النظام من استخدامها بكفاءة. عدم وجود ملف صفحة يفرض على نظام التشغيل استخدام RAM بشكل غير فعال لسببين:
- أولاً ، لا يمكن أن تجعل الصفحات قابلة للتجاهل ، حتى لو لم يتم الوصول إليها أو تعديلها في وقت طويل جدًا ، مما يفرض أن تكون ذاكرة التخزين المؤقت للقرص أصغر.
- ثانياً ، عليها أن تحتفظ بذاكرة الوصول العشوائي الفعلية لدعم التخصيصات التي من غير المحتمل أن تتطلبها (على سبيل المثال ، تعيين ملف خاص ، قابل للتعديل) ، مما يؤدي إلى حالة حيث يمكنك الحصول على الكثير من ذاكرة الوصول العشوائي الفعلية ، ومع ذلك يتم رفض التخصيصات تجنب الافراط في الالتزام.
خذ بعين الاعتبار ، على سبيل المثال ، إذا كان برنامج يجعل تعيين ذاكرة خاصة للكتابة من ملف 4 غيغابايت. يجب على نظام التشغيل حجز 4 جيجابايت من ذاكرة الوصول العشوائي لهذا التعيين لأن البرنامج يمكن أن يعدل كل بايت ولا يوجد مكان إلا ذاكرة الوصول العشوائي لتخزينه. لذا من البداية ، تهدر ذاكرة الوصول العشوائي (RAM) 4 غيغابايت (يمكن استخدامها في تخزين صفحات الأقراص النظيفة ، ولكن هذا الأمر يتعلق بها).
يجب أن يكون لديك ملف صفحة إذا كنت ترغب في الحصول على أقصى استفادة من ذاكرة الوصول العشوائي (RAM) ، حتى لو لم يتم استخدامها. يعمل بمثابة بوليصة تأمين تسمح لنظام التشغيل باستخدام ذاكرة الوصول العشوائي فعليًا ، بدلاً من الاضطرار إلى حجزها لإمكانيات غير محتملة بشكل كبير.
الأشخاص الذين صمموا سلوك نظام التشغيل الخاص بك ليسوا أغبياء. إن امتلاك ملف صفحة يمنح نظام التشغيل المزيد من الخيارات ، ولن يجعلها سيئة.
ليس هناك نقطة في محاولة لوضع ملف صفحة في ذاكرة الوصول العشوائي. وإذا كان لديك الكثير من ذاكرة الوصول العشوائي ، فمن المستبعد جدًا استخدام ملف الصفحة (يجب أن يكون هناك فقط) ، لذلك لا يهم مدى سرعة تشغيل الجهاز على وجه الخصوص..
تأكد من الاطلاع على موضوع المناقشة النشط حول الموضوع من خلال الرابط أدناه!
هل لديك شيء تضيفه إلى الشرح؟ الصوت قبالة في التعليقات. هل ترغب في قراءة المزيد من الإجابات من مستخدمي Stack Exchange الآخرين المحترفين بالتكنولوجيا؟ تحقق من موضوع المناقشة الكامل هنا.